Analysis of fatal motorcycle crashes: crash typing   总被引:8,自引:0,他引:8  
There were 2074 crashes fatal to a motorcycle driver in the United States during 1992. A computer program was developed to convert Fatal Accident Reporting System (FARS) data for these crashes into standard format English language “crash reports.” The computer generated reports were analyzed and crash type categories were defined. Five defined crash type categories accounted for 1785 (86%) of the 2074 crash events: Ran off-road (41%); ran traffic control (18%); oncoming or head-on (11%); left-turn oncoming (8%); and motorcyclist down (7%). Alcohol and excessive speed were common factors associated with motorcyclist crash involvement. Left turns and failure to yield were common factors associated with the involvement of other motorists. Suggested countermeasures include helmet use and enforcement of speed and impaired driving laws.  相似文献

Motorcycle crashes frequently involve a combination of high-risk behaviors by the motorcyclist or the other crash-involved driver. Such behaviors may include riding or driving without appropriate licensure or while under the influence of alcohol, as well as deciding not to use a safety device such as a helmet or safety belt. Given that these factors frequently occur in combination with one another, it is difficult to untangle the specific effects of individual factors leading up to the crash outcome. This study assesses how various rider-, driver-, and other crash-specific factors contribute to at-fault status in two-vehicle motorcycle crashes, as well as how these same factors affect the propensity for other high-risk behaviors. Furthermore, the interrelationships among fault status and these other behaviors are also examined using a multivariate probit model. This model is developed using police-reported crash data for the years 2006–2010 from the State of Ohio. The results show that younger motorcyclists are more likely to be at-fault in the event of a collision, as are riders who are under the influence of alcohol, riding without insurance, or not wearing a helmet. Similarly, motorcyclists were less likely to be at-fault when the other driver was of younger age or was driving under the influence of alcohol, without insurance, or not wearing their safety belt. Crash-involved parties who engaged in one high-risk behavior were more likely to engage in other such behaviors, as well, and this finding was consistent for both motorcyclists and drivers. The results of this study suggest that educational and enforcement strategies aimed at addressing any one of these behaviors are likely to have tangential impacts on the other behaviors, as well.  相似文献

A cohort of 4729 junior college students in an urban and a rural area in Taiwan was followed up for a period of 20 months. Students' characteristics, including riding exposures, as well as human, vehicular, and environmental factors were collected using one initial and three follow-up questionnaires. The Anderson-Gill (AG) multiplicative intensity model was used to determine the risk of a motorcycle crash over time while also allowing for the modeling of multiple events. The average response rate for the four assessments was 92%. The adjusted relative hazard (RH) for students living in the rural as opposed to the urban area for crashes was 1.67 at the beginning of the study but decreased to 0.66 by the end. Past motorcycle crash history, number of riding days, average riding distance, risk-taking level, alcohol consumption, and traffic violations were all significantly associated with an increased risk of being involved in a crash. Conversely, increasing age, riding experience, and automobile licensure were related to a decreased risk of crashing. Furthermore, helmet use was not independently related to the risk of crashing. In conclusion, a high-risk group predisposed to involvement in a motorcycle crash, including both non-injury and injury-related crashes, can be identified using selected risk factors for crash prevention among young riders.  相似文献

The aim of the study presented here has been to see what the effects of the new traffic safety law are, 2 years into its initial implementation, on driving under the influence of alcohol. Until the end of 2009, the legal limit for blood concentration for drivers in Serbia was 0.5 g/l; however, the new traffic safety law stipulates the new limit to be 0.3 g/l. A retrospective autopsy study was performed over a 6-year period (from 2006 to 2011) whose sample covered cases of fatally injured drivers who had died at the scene of the incident, before being admitted to hospital. A total of 161 fatally injured drivers were examined for their blood alcohol concentration. The average age for these drivers was 40.2 ± 15.4 years, with a significant male predominance of 152 men to 9 women (χ2 = 152.000, p < 0.001). This study has shown no decrease in the ratio of drivers under the influence of alcohol vs. all drivers (Pearson χ2 = 4.415, df = 5, p = 0.491), nor in the number of drivers under the influence of alcohol (Pearson χ2 = 6.629, df = 5, p = 0.250), nor a decrease in the mean blood alcohol concentration in drivers (1.72 ± 0.87 vs. 1.68 ± 0.95 g/l, t = 0.177, df = 80, p = 0.860). The conclusion of this study is that the new law has had a limited effect on driving under the influence of alcohol, which still remains one of the major human factors, responsible for road-traffic crashes in Serbia.  相似文献

Crash statistics that include the blood alcohol concentration (BAC) of vehicle operators reveal that crash involved motorcyclists are over represented at low BACs (e.g., ≤0.05%). This riding simulator study compared riding performance and hazard response under three low dose alcohol conditions (sober, 0.02% BAC, 0.05% BAC). Forty participants (20 novice, 20 experienced) completed simulated rides in urban and rural scenarios while responding to a safety-critical peripheral detection task (PDT). Results showed a significant increase in the standard deviation of lateral position in the urban scenario and PDT reaction time in the rural scenario under 0.05% BAC compared with zero alcohol. Participants were most likely to collide with an unexpected pedestrian in the urban scenario at 0.02% BAC, with novice participants at a greater relative risk than experienced riders. Novices chose to ride faster than experienced participants in the rural scenario regardless of BAC. Not all results were significant, emphasising the complex situation of the effects of low dose BAC on riding performance, which needs further research. The results of this simulator study provide some support for a legal BAC for motorcyclists below 0.05%.  相似文献

This study aims to develop motorcycle ownership and usage models with consideration of the state dependence and heterogeneity effects based on a large-scale questionnaire panel survey on vehicle owners. To account for the independence among alternatives and heterogeneity among individuals, the modeling structure of motorcycle ownership adopts disaggregate choice models considering the multinomial, nested, and mixed logit formulations. Three types of panel data regression models – ordinary, fixed, and random effects – are developed and compared for motorcycle usage. The estimation results show that motorcycle ownership in the previous year does exercise a significantly positive effect on the number of motorcycles owned by households in the current year, suggesting that the state dependence effect does exist in motorcycle ownership decisions. In addition, the fixed effects model is the preferred specification for modeling motorcycle usage, indicating strong evidence for existence of heterogeneity. Among various management strategies evaluated under different scenarios, increasing gas prices and parking fees will lead to larger reductions in total kilometers traveled.  相似文献

Motorcyclists are over-represented in collision statistics. While many collisions may be the direct fault of another road user, a considerable number of fatalities and injuries are due to the actions of the rider. While increased riding experience may improve skills, advanced training courses may be required to evoke the safest riding behaviours. The current research assessed the impact of experience and advanced training on rider behaviour using a motorcycle simulator. Novice riders, experienced riders and riders with advanced training traversed a virtual world through varying speed limits and roadways of different curvature. Speed and lane position were monitored. In a comparison of 60 mph and 40 mph zones, advanced riders rode more slowly in the 40 mph zones, and had greater variation in lane position than the other two groups. In the 60 mph zones, both advanced and experienced riders had greater lane variation than novices. Across the whole ride, novices tended to position themselves closer to the kerb. In a second analysis across four classifications of curvature (straight, slight, medium, tight) advanced and experienced riders varied their lateral position more so than novices, though advanced riders had greater variation in lane position than even experienced riders in some conditions. The results suggest that experience and advanced training lead to changes in behaviour compared to novice riders which can be interpreted as having a potentially positive impact on road safety.  相似文献

OBJECTIVE: To explore associations of state retail alcohol monopolies with underage drinking and alcohol-impaired driving deaths. DATA: Surveys on youth who drank alcohol and binge-drank recently and their beverage choices; census of motor vehicle fatalities by driver blood alcohol level. METHODS: Regressions estimated associations of monopolies with under-21 drinking, binge drinking, alcohol-impaired driving deaths, and odds a driver under 21 who died was alcohol-positive. RESULTS: About 93.8% of those ages 12-20 who consumed alcohol in the past month drank some wine or spirits. In states with a retail monopoly over spirits or wine and spirits, an average of 14.5% fewer high school students reported drinking alcohol in the past 30 days and 16.7% fewer reported binge drinking in the past 30 days than high school students in non-monopoly states. Monopolies over both wine and spirits were associated with larger consumption reductions than monopolies over spirits only. Lower consumption rates in monopoly states, in turn, were associated with a 9.3% lower alcohol-impaired driving death rate under age 21 in monopoly states versus non-monopoly states. Alcohol monopolies may prevent 45 impaired driving deaths annually. CONCLUSIONS: Continuing existing retail alcohol monopolies should help control underage drinking and associated harms.  相似文献

Alcohol intoxication is a significant risk factor for fatal traffic crashes; however, there is sparse research on the impairing effects of alcohol on skills involved in motorcycle control. Twenty-four male motorcycle riders between the ages of 21 and 50 were assessed on a test track with task scenarios based on the Motorcycle Safety Foundation's (MSF) training program. A balanced incomplete block design was used to remove confounding artifacts (learning effects) by randomizing four BAC levels across three test days. In general, intoxicated riders demonstrated longer response times and adopted larger tolerances leading to more task performance errors. Most of the alcohol effects were evident at the per se 0.08% alcohol level, but some of the effects were observed at the lower 0.05% alcohol level. The effects of alcohol on motorcycle control and rider behavior were modest and occurred when task demand was high (offset weave), time pressure was high (hazard avoidance for near obstacles), and tolerances were constrained (circuit track). The modest effects may be due to the study design, in which experienced riders performed highly practiced, low-speed tasks; alcohol at these levels may produce larger effects with less experienced riders in more challenging situations.  相似文献

Purpose

Many studies have examined the role of peer and parental alcohol use on drinking behaviors among adolescents. Few studies, however, have examined parental influences on driving under the influence (DUI) of alcohol. The current study uses data from a longitudinal study to examine the role of parental alcohol use during adolescence on the risk for DUI among young adult men and women.

Methods

Data were derived from 9559 adolescents and young adults who participated in the National Longitudinal Study of Adolescent Health (Add Health) Waves I and III. Survey logistic regression was used to examine the relationship between multilevel risk and protective factors and self-reported DUI. Analyses were stratified by gender and frequency of parental alcohol consumption to understand the role of parental alcohol use on risk for DUI among their youth.

Results

Risk and protective factors for DUI were very similar among men and women. Parental alcohol use significantly predicted DUI among women (OR = 1.39, p < 0.01) and men (OR = 1.33, p < 0.05). When parents did not report alcohol use, peer alcohol use significantly increased risk for DUI for both women (OR = 1.26, p < 0.05) and men (OR = 1.31, p < 0.001). When parents reported alcohol use, however, peer alcohol use was not a significant independent predictor.

Conclusions

Findings suggest remarkable similarities in risk and protective factors for DUI across gender groups. For men and women, parental alcohol consumption was a risk factor for DUI. Peers’ alcohol use predicted DUI only when parents did not use alcohol.  相似文献

Background: In the past few decades, numerous policies, including those that lower legal blood alcohol concentration limits, have been enacted to reduce alcohol-impaired driving. In the US, 41 states and the District of Columbia have enacted 0.08 per se laws, which specify that if a driver’s BAC is at or above 0.08, a violation has occurred even if the driver does not show signs of intoxication. Objective: We examined effects of lowering the blood alcohol concentration limit to 0.08 per se on fatal traffic crashes in 18 states and the District of Columbia, and whether effects of the law varied by state or by baseline rates of fatal traffic crashes. Method: Data on fatal traffic crashes were obtained from the Fatality Analysis Reporting System, including all states that enacted 0.08 per se prior to 2001 in the contiguous United States. Effects of the 0.08 law were examined in each state separately, and the overall effect across states was examined using a mixed-model Poisson regression on single-vehicle-nighttime fatal traffic crashes. Results: State-specific analyses showed that fatal traffic crashes significantly decreased in three of the 19 states following the introduction of the 0.08 law, prior to adjusting for potential confounders. The mixed-model regression showed a statistically significant 5.2% reduction in single-vehicle-nighttime fatal traffic crashes associated with the 0.08 law across all states, after adjusting for administrative license revocation, the number of Friday and Saturday nights in a month, and trends in all other types of fatal traffic crashes. Findings indicate that the effect of the 0.08 law does not vary significantly by state or baseline rate of fatal traffic crashes in a state, and no significant statistical interaction exists between 0.08 and administrative license revocation policy effects.  相似文献

This paper examines ethnic disparities in rates of driving under the influence of alcohol (DUIA) in a representative sample of Ontario adults. Data were drawn from the Centre for Addiction and Mental Health (CAMH) Monitor, a survey of 8276 Ontario adults aged 18 and older. We considered 19 distinct ethnic groups based on participants’ self-identification of ethno-cultural heritage. Differences in the prevalence of DUIA across ethnic groups were limited. Relative to other ethnic groups, those adults who identified as Irish had a significantly higher rate of DUIA, while those of Italian and Chinese ethnicity had significantly lower rates of DUIA. The mediating effects of psychological distress (General Health Questionnaire) and harmful and problematic drinking (Alcohol Use Disorders Identification Test [AUDIT] consumption, dependence and problems) on the direct relationship between ethnic identity and impaired driving were also considered. Mediation was observed as remaining ethnic differences in DUIA disappeared when AUDIT subscales were introduced. These findings are interpreted in the context of patterns of alcohol consumption among ethnic populations and their impact on DUIA. Implications of study findings are considered with respect to the role of ethnicity in impaired driving research and its impact on programs and policies directed at reducing impaired driving.  相似文献

Background

While helmet usage is often mandated, few motorcycle and scooter riders make full use of protection for the rest of the body. Little is known about the factors associated with riders’ usage or non-usage of protective clothing.

Methods

Novice riders were surveyed prior to their provisional licence test in NSW, Australia. Questions related to usage and beliefs about protective clothing, riding experience and exposure, risk taking and demographic details. Multivariable Poisson regression models were used to identify factors associated with two measures of usage, comparing those who sometimes vs rarely/never rode unprotected and who usually wore non-motorcycle pants vs motorcycle pants.

Results

Ninety-four percent of eligible riders participated and usable data was obtained from 66% (n = 776). Factors significantly associated with riding unprotected were: youth (17–25 years) (RR = 2.00, 95% CI: 1.50–2.65), not seeking protective clothing information (RR = 1.29, 95% CI = 1.07–1.56), non-usage in hot weather (RR = 3.01, 95% CI: 2.38–3.82), awareness of social pressure to wear more protection (RR = 1.48, 95% CI: 1.12–1.95), scepticism about protective benefits (RR = 2.00, 95% CI: 1.22–3.28) and riding a scooter vs any type of motorcycle. A similar cluster of factors including youth (RR = 1.17, 95% CI: 1.04–1.32), social pressure (RR = 1.32, 95% CI: 1.16–1.50), hot weather (RR = 1.30, 95% CI: 1.19–1.41) and scooter vs motorcycles were also associated with wearing non-motorcycle pants. There was no evidence of an association between use of protective clothing and other indicators of risk taking behaviour.

Conclusions

Factors strongly associated with non-use of protective clothing include not having sought information about protective clothing and not believing in its injury reduction value. Interventions to increase use may therefore need to focus on development of credible information sources about crash risk and the benefits of protective clothing. Further work is required to develop motorcycle protective clothing suitable for hot climates.  相似文献

Per vehicle mile traveled, motorcycle riders have a 34-fold higher risk of death in a crash than people driving other types of motor vehicles. While lower-extremity injuries most commonly occur in all motorcycle crashes, head injuries are most frequent in fatal crashes. Helmets and helmet use laws have been shown to be effective in reducing head injuries and deaths from motorcycle crashes. Alcohol is the major contributing factor to fatal crashes. Enforcement of legal limits on the blood alcohol concentration is effective in reducing motorcycle deaths, while some alcohol-related interventions such as a minimal legal drinking age, increased alcohol excise taxes, and responsible beverage service specifically for motorcycle riders have not been examined. Other modifiable protective or risk factors comprise inexperience and driver training, conspicuity and daytime headlight laws, motorcycle licensure and ownership, riding speed, and risk-taking behaviors. Features of motorcycle use and potentially effective prevention programs for motorcycle crash injuries in developing countries are discussed. Finally, recommendations for future motorcycle-injury research are made.  相似文献

Sleepiness is related to factors such as the time of day, the time since awakening and the duration of prior sleep. The present study investigated whether actual road crashes could be predicted from a mathematical model based on these three factors (the Sleep/Wake Predictor-SWP). Data were derived from a population-based case-control study of serious injury crashes. Data on accident time (or control sampling time) and start and end of prior sleep were entered into the model (blind). The predicted sleepiness values were used in logistic regressions. The results showed a highly significant odds ratio (OR)=1.72 (confidence interval=1.41-2.09) for each incremental step of sleepiness on the output sleepiness scale (nine steps). There was also a significant interaction with blood alcohol level, showing high OR values for high sleepiness levels and alcohol levels above 50 mg% (0.05 g/dl). It was concluded that the model is a good predictor of road crashes beyond that of alcohol level, and that interaction between the two carries a very high risk.  相似文献

Background

Driving under the influence of multiple substances is a public health concern, but there is little epidemiological data about their combined use and putative impact on driving in low and middle-income countries where traffic crashes have been clustering in recent years. The aim of this study is to estimate the prevalence of alcohol and drug use – as well as their associated factors – among drivers in the context of alcohol outlets (AOs).

Methods

A probability three-stage sample survey was conducted in Porto Alegre, Brazil. Individuals who were leaving AO were screened, with the selection of 683 drivers who met the inclusion criteria. Drivers answered a structured interview, were breathalyzed, and had their saliva collected for drug screening. Prevalences were assessed using domain estimation and logistic regression models assessed covariates associated with substance use.

Findings

Benzodiazepines 3.9% (SE 2.13) and cocaine 3.8% (SE 1.3) were the most frequently detected drugs in saliva. Among drivers who were going to drive, 11% had at least one drug identified by the saliva drug screening, 0.4% two, and 0.1% three drugs in addition to alcohol. In multivariable analyses, having a blood alcohol concentration (BAC) > 0.06% was found to be associated with a 3.64 times (CI 95% 1.79–7.39) higher chance of drug detection, compared with interviewees with lower BACs.

Conclusions

To drive under the influence of multiple substances is likely to be found in this setting, highlighting an association between harmful patterns of consume of alcohol and the misuse of other substances.  相似文献

BackgroundAlcohol-impaired driving accounts for substantial proportion of traffic-related fatalities in the U.S. Risk perceptions for drinking and driving have been associated with various measures of drinking and driving behavior. In an effort to understand how to intervene and to better understand how risk perceptions may be shaped, this study explored whether an objective environmental-level measure (proportion of alcohol-involved driving crashes in one’s residential city) were related to individual-level perceptions and behavior.MethodsUsing data from a 2012 cross-sectional roadside survey of 1147 weekend nighttime drivers in California, individual-level self-reported acceptance of drinking and driving and past-year drinking and driving were merged with traffic crash data using respondent ZIP codes. Population average logistic regression modeling was conducted for the odds of acceptance of drinking and driving and self-reported, past-year drinking and driving.ResultsA non-linear relationship between city-level alcohol-involved traffic crashes and individual-level acceptance of drinking and driving was found. Acceptance of drinking and driving did not mediate the relationship between the proportion of alcohol-involved traffic crashes and self-reported drinking and driving behavior. However, it was directly related to behavior among those most likely to drink outside the home.DiscussionThe present study surveys a particularly relevant population and is one of few drinking and driving studies to evaluate the relationship between an objective environmental-level crash risk measure and individual-level risk perceptions. In communities with both low and high proportions of alcohol-involved traffic crashes there was low acceptance of drinking and driving. This may mean that in communities with low proportions of crashes, citizens have less permissive norms around drinking and driving, whereas in communities with a high proportion of crashes, the incidence of these crashes may serve as an environmental cue which informs drinking and driving perceptions. Perceptual information on traffic safety can be used to identify places where people may be at greater risk for drinking and driving. Community-level traffic fatalities may be a salient cue for tailoring risk communication.  相似文献

Objectives

Motor vehicle crashes are the leading cause of adolescent deaths. Programs and policies should target the most common and modifiable reasons for crashes. We estimated the frequency of critical reasons for crashes involving teen drivers, and examined in more depth specific teen driver errors.

Methods

The National Highway Traffic Safety Administration's (NHTSA) National Motor Vehicle Crash Causation Survey collected data at the scene of a nationally representative sample of 5470 serious crashes between 7/05 and 12/07. NHTSA researchers assigned a single driver, vehicle, or environmental factor as the critical reason for the event immediately leading to each crash. We analyzed crashes involving 15–18 year old drivers.

Results

822 teen drivers were involved in 795 serious crashes, representing 335,667 teens in 325,291 crashes. Driver error was by far the most common reason for crashes (95.6%), as opposed to vehicle or environmental factors. Among crashes with a driver error, a teen made the error 79.3% of the time (75.8% of all teen-involved crashes). Recognition errors (e.g., inadequate surveillance, distraction) accounted for 46.3% of all teen errors, followed by decision errors (e.g., following too closely, too fast for conditions) (40.1%) and performance errors (e.g., loss of control) (8.0%). Inadequate surveillance, driving too fast for conditions, and distracted driving together accounted for almost half of all crashes. Aggressive driving behavior, drowsy driving, and physical impairments were less commonly cited as critical reasons. Males and females had similar proportions of broadly classified errors, although females were specifically more likely to make inadequate surveillance errors.

Conclusions

Our findings support prioritization of interventions targeting driver distraction and surveillance and hazard awareness training.  相似文献

Many studies show that driving at night is more risky in terms of crash involvements per distance travelled than driving during the day. The reasons for this include the more prevalent use of alcohol by drivers at night, the effects of fatigue on the driving task and the risk associated with reduced visibility. Although the consumption of alcohol prior to driving occurs most commonly at night, drink-driving is not inherently a night time risk factor. This study decomposes the New Zealand risk of driving at night into risk associated with alcohol and risk associated with inherently night time factors. The overall risk associated with alcohol use by drivers was shown to decrease with increasing age for the most risky situation analysed (male drivers on weekend nights). Given the levels of drinking and driving on weekend nights, the overall effect of alcohol was shown to contribute almost half of weekend night time risk for drivers aged under 40 on lower volume roads, but to contribute little to overall risk on higher-volume roads, consistent with other research showing that higher-volume roads are not favoured by drinking drivers. Risk at night relative to risk during the day (excluding risk associated with drinking and driving) was shown to decrease with age. Roads with illumination at night are less risky at night relative to during the day than roads without illumination. The risks estimated in this paper reflect the behaviour of the road users studied and their prevalence on the roads under the conditions analysed.  相似文献

Accidents stemming from alcohol-impaired driving are the leading cause of injury and death among college students. Research has implicated certain driver personality characteristics in the majority of these motor vehicle crashes. Sensation seeking in particular has been linked to risky driving, alcohol consumption, and driving while intoxicated. This study investigated the effect of sensation seeking on self-reported alcohol-impaired driving behavior in a college student population while adjusting for demographics, residence and drinking locations. A total of 1587 college students over the age of 18 completed a health screening survey while presenting for routine, non-urgent care at campus heath services centers. Student demographics, living situation, most common drinking location, heavy episodic drinking, sensation-seeking disposition and alcohol-impaired driving behavior were assessed. Using a full-form logistic regression model to isolate sensation seeking after adjusting for covariates, sensation seeking remains a statistically significant independent predictor of alcohol-impaired driving behavior (OR = 1.52; CI = 1.19-1.94; p < 0.001). Older, white, sensation-seeking college students who engage in heavy episodic drinking, live off-campus, and go to bars are at highest risk for alcohol-impaired driving behaviors. Interventions should target sensation seekers and environmental factors that mediate the link between sensation seeking and alcohol-impaired driving behaviors.  相似文献
